Transaction bbcf59a8bc46f1a487ebf49a71402811c3cdb3b84c76724590cbbc9d5425e8e3

2 Input
1 Outputs
  • bbcf59a8bc46f1a487ebf49a71402811c3cdb3b84c76724590cbbc9d5425e8e3:0
  • value  21857147
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u